IP查询
查询
你查询的IP:[120.185.190.92] 地理位置:印度尼西亚
最新查询
218.82.126.190
221.96.164.141
221.214.18.59
221.89.154.201
221.30.184.162
120.198.197.205
119.232.8.2
119.114.84.216
221.54.187.121
120.185.190.92
116.214.128.157
202.142.16.12
116.66.28.160
124.240.187.80
118.132.164.29
60.253.128.37
124.254.8.32
202.74.8.232
202.173.224.65
121.255.238.148
202.136.208.21
203.142.219.29
220.101.192.125
203.191.64.5
119.10.213.81
221.196.20.16
203.92.160.6
124.128.74.105
124.200.217.139
202.38.140.160
203.176.168.131